Abstract
A method for reducing gastrointestinal inflammation, enhancing growth, or improving feed efficiency in a human or non-human animal is disclosed. The method involves administering to the animal an agent that can reduce the formation of the signal transduction complex of endotoxin, TLR4 and CD14 on the cellular surface of a cell in the gastrointestinal tract of the animal. In a preferred embodiment, an antibody against the extracellular domain of TLR4 or CD14 is used to reduce the formation of the complex. A composition that contains the antibody and an ingestible carrier is also disclosed. Further disclosed is a method for producing a peptide for enhancing growth, improving feed efficiency, or both in a human or non-human animal.
